New Jersey Statutes, Title: 18A, EDUCATION
Chapter 58: School lunch program
Section: 18A:58-37.6: Expenditure of aid for textbooks.
6. State aid provided pursuant to P.L.2007, c.260 (C.18A:7F-43 et al.) may be expended for the purchase and loan of textbooks for public school pupils in an amount which shall not exceed the State average budgeted textbook expense for the prebudget year per pupil in resident enrollment. Nothing contained herein shall prohibit a board of education in any district from purchasing textbooks in excess of the amounts provided pursuant to this act.
L.1974, c.79, s.6; amended 1979, c.194, s.2; 1990, c.52, s.77; 1996, c.138, s.83; 2007, c.260, s.76.
